Transaction 295c504693321411d0a0d6a121a66a684b39a347cd9855e21105c1c9ee3c4c8e
1 Input
2 Outputs
- 295c504693321411d0a0d6a121a66a684b39a347cd9855e21105c1c9ee3c4c8e:0
- 295c504693321411d0a0d6a121a66a684b39a347cd9855e21105c1c9ee3c4c8e:1
value 5000000
address 16vRKGJThpFg9D4HYtQgLtLozS6pJCM8zf
value 21809030
address 1NKdmwbvxZtQHtLFkDYfjyLsH4bx4mDGfD